Intense weekend for the Italian alpine skier, the men are idle | Alpine skiing

Italian expert Federica Brignone showed great momentum during the women’s Alpine Skiing World Cup stage at the Canadian Ski Center in Tremblant, winning both giant slaloms.

On Saturday, Brignone beat Slovakian Petra Vlhova and American Mikaela Shiffrin to become the oldest giant slalom winner in MK series history at age 33. Sunday postponed the maximum score for another day.

At the same time, Brignone only held sixth position after the first descent on Sunday, but after the second descent the next five climbers could not stay ahead of him.

Brignone (2.11.95) preceded the Swiss Lara Gut-Behram (+0.33) and Shiffrin (+0.39) by two runs. Vlhova, in the lead after the initial descent, settled for fifth place (+0.67) behind the Frenchwoman Clara Direz (+0.45).

The experience came in handy for the Italian race, as the riders had to deal with a good amount of snow. “The second descent was very difficult,” admitted the winner. “I tried to put everything on the line, I knew the conditions were very difficult because we couldn’t see, it was snowing and it was windy.”

“But I usually feel good in these conditions. My brother told me before the second descent that it’s fine, we’ve been training in these conditions for a month.”

If Brignone had set an age-related record the day before, on Sunday she also became the first Italian woman to record 23 stage victories in the MK. So far she has shared first place with Sofia Goggia.

There is currently an unusual situation in the Alpine Skiing World Cup series, as the women already have seven races, but only one for the men. For various reasons, most of the planned undertakings were cancelled.

This past weekend, Beaver Creek was unable to host either the scheduled downhill races or one of the giant slalom races. In America, athletes were disturbed by heavy snow and strong winds.
